这是 XML/RSS Feed 文件:
<?xml version="1.0" encoding="ISO-8859-1" ?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"
xmlns:geo="http://www.w3.org/2003/01/geo/wgs84_pos#"
xmlns:georss="http://www.georss.org/georss">
<channel>
...
<item>
...
</item>
<item>
...
</item>
</channel>
</rss>
如果我想通过套接字获取文件,例如:
Socket socket = new Socket(/* THE SITE*/ , 80);
OutputStream os = socket.getOutputStream();
OutputStreamWritter osw = new OutputStreamWritter(os);
BufferedWriter bw = new BufferWriter(osw);
bw.write("HEADER OF THE SITE");
我应该使用什么 header ?
最佳答案
您应该了解 HTTP 或使用更高级的 API,例如 java.net.HttpURLConnection
。
关于java - XML 1.0/RSS 2.0 文档的标题?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13245852/